Inscription

66,740,089

Inscription Details

Inscription ID
0aa34d......eea3i0
Number
66,740,089
Owner
bc1qnv......utlqv8
Output Size
1,899,990,000 Sats
Content Type
text/plain;charset=utf-8
Content Size
0.05 KB
Creation Date
March 31, 2024. 477 days ago
Creation Fee
1,359 Sats
Creation Tx
0aa34d......d1eea3
Block
837037
Previous
188ed6......7aa2i0
Next
2ce261......cba9i0

Satoshi Details

Sat Number
1,962,720,851,086,738
Sat Name
ygixekzwrn
Sat Creation Block
830,353
Sat Creation Date
2/14/2024
Rarity
common